Otherwise, more information:  I'm running a RH 5.0 system, and I've
installed all of the .20 rpms along with all of the "jpeg fixes" for
RH 5.1.  I did install some earlier versions of gnome, both with
tarballs and rpms.  Could this be a problem?

> I get this error upon starting gnome:
> 
> [levanti@crucifix levanti]$ gnome-session
> SESSION_MANAGER=local/crucifix:/tmp/.ICE-unix/1824,tcp/crucifix:10570
> gmcconnected
> /panel/
> debug: need old_cfg here
>: error in loading shared libraries
> /usr/lib/libgtk.so.1: undefined symbol: g_strdelimit
> 
> ** ERROR **: sigsegv caught
> 
> ** ERROR **: sigint caught   
> 
> So I tried doing panel:
> 
> [levanti@crucifix levanti]$ panel &
> [1] 1822
> [levanti@crucifix levanti]$ debug: need old_cfg here
> // Hit Ctrl-C
> [1]+  Segmentation fault      panel
